Output 421327396bdd7cf569d89df6b68ecba8d4885d44226ed00a767dbd277e02e25f:3

value
53308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d68ea93b66ba14635e7d1f677bdd17a5b01763677811e104e523a1228feebe15
address
bc1p6682jwmxhg2xxhnaranhhhgh5kcpwcm80qg7zp89ywsj9rlwhc2spa6mtf
transaction
421327396bdd7cf569d89df6b68ecba8d4885d44226ed00a767dbd277e02e25f
confirmations
80272
spent
true